CEIA OPENGATE High Throughput Weapons Screening – CEIA Pacific is showing the CEIA OPENGATE weapons detection system, an open walk-through solution designed for high-throughput screening of people carrying backpacks, purses and bags without requiring bags to be removed.
Manufactured by CEIA in Italy, OPENGATE is designed to detect a range of metal threats, including multi-calibre weapons and IEDs, while allowing people to move through the screening point with their personal items.
Unlike conventional walk-through metal detector gates, OPENGATE comprises 2 freestanding pillars with no mechanical or electrical connection between them. The arch-free design eliminates the crossbar and allows the pillars to be rapidly positioned to create a screening lane.
According to CEIA, the system weighs around 12kg and can be set up in less than 1 minute without adjustment, assembly or connection of mechanical and electrical components between the pillars. This portability allows OPENGATE to be relocated between entrances or screening locations as requirements change.
The system is suitable for indoor and outdoor operation and can be powered by lithium-ion batteries or a standard mains supply. Acoustic and optical indicators at the top of the pillars provide system status and alarm indications, with the top cap designed to maintain alarm visibility in direct sunlight.

OPENGATE incorporates a high-precision transit counter and is intended for applications requiring high pedestrian throughput with low nuisance alarm rates. Typical applications include stadiums, arenas, theme parks, hospitals, museums, theatres, convention centres, transport hubs and other public locations where large numbers of people require screening.
Detection and signalling parameters can be remotely configured using the OPENGATE app from Android and iOS smartphones and tablets.
